The Role
As a Senior Project Manager you will be leading on strategically important projects that make a tangible difference to the UKs National Security. You will be familiar with or eager to work within, the cyber domain; and you will be comfortable bridging the gap between customer and QinetiQ offices.


Day-to-day, you will bring effective management and delivery of the projects to agreed baselines, developing and growing customer relationships, securing associated follow-on sales, supporting major bids and successfully contributing to the overall strategy and business targets.

Your responsibilities will include:

  • Development and maintenance of positive engagement with project customers, partners and suppliers
  • Successful delivery of the Project outcomes
  • Maintenance of forecasts, both financial and resource demand signals
  • Application of governance requirements (including lifecycle, project and independent reviews as appropriate) for foundation sales and delivery work
  • Reporting progress on all accountabilities to the Business

Essential experience of the Senior Project Manager :

  • Previous experience working with National Security customers
  • Ability to manage multiple stakeholders, PMs and subcontractors simultaneously with sound communication skills
  • Requires proven track record in delivering complex technical projects, dealing with demanding timescales, uncertainty and risk
  • Experience of managing internal teams and external partnerships in order to meet contractual requirements

Essential qualifications for the Senior Project Manager:

  • Demonstrable capability to APM PMQ or equivalent
  • Applicants should hold DV

We value difference and we don’t have a fixed idea when it comes to background or education, provided you can show the required level of experience and willingness to learn then we would like to hear from you.


This role is 37 hours per week; with your time being split between our Malvern site and customer sites.

Malvern

The Malvern facility is noted for its work in electronic warfare, surveillance and complex system integration, contributing significantly to the UK’s defence capabilities. Developing technologies for military and civilian applications, including sensors, communications and cyber security.
